Which type of vacuum truck do I need for my job in Valley Acres?

It depends on the work: hydrovac and air vacuum trucks dig safely around utilities, combo trucks clean sewers and pipes, and liquid or liquid-ring units recover fluids and slurry. Describe your Valley Acres job and we match it to service providers with the right equipment.
